Output 08e31d31147e8d203141ae5345cff1fa8184184fde7c8c61b65a40c84c6ea8f1:179

value
14936
script pubkey
OP_0 OP_PUSHBYTES_20 75bed4b9ebffb41b5f36d3aa68d27b8d4dc78037
address
bc1qwkldfw0tl76pkhek6w4x35nm34xu0qphve02uf
transaction
08e31d31147e8d203141ae5345cff1fa8184184fde7c8c61b65a40c84c6ea8f1
spent
true